Media release – Tasmanian Electoral Commission, 23 February 2022

Counting completed for the Derwent Valley and West Coast council by-elections

The counting of votes for the Derwent Valley and West Coast by-elections have been completed today.

The following candidates have been elected to serve until the forthcoming ordinary elections (due to be held September/October 2022):

Derwent Valley Council

Michelle Dracoulis has been elected as councillor.

Michelle Dracoulis has been elected as mayor.

West Coast Council

Robert Butterfield has been elected as councillor.

Audit of mayor by-election ballot papers conducted

Following the completion of count 4 of the Derwent Valley Council mayor by-election only 1 vote separated Julie Triffett and Jessica Cosgrove, with one of these candidates to be excluded at count 5.

Due to the narrow margin, the returning officer conducted a full audit of all ballot papers to that point of the election to confirm the order of exclusion. The audit identified no errors in the count, confirming the 1 vote margin.
